Yesterday, January 28, an incident involving fire occurred on the shore of Lake Issyk-Kul in the Ton district of the Issyk-Kul region.

The flames were spotted east of the village of Kara-Talaa, which is part of the Ula-Khol rural district.

According to information from the Ministry of Emergency Situations representative office in the Issyk-Kul region, the fire broke out in the territory of the natural reserve "Ak-Bulun." To extinguish it, at 17:24, one firefighting unit from the fire and rescue station No. 19 in the city of Balykchy was dispatched to the scene.

Control over the fire was established at 21:30, and its complete extinguishment occurred at 24:05.

In the firefighting efforts, 6 representatives of the village administration, 3 forestry workers, 3 police officers, about 20 local residents, and 5 employees of the district Ministry of Emergency Situations participated.
